This copper mineral has banded circles of green that give it a all-natural natural beauty. Malachite has also been connected symbolically with money.
This number of quartz has light-weight green hues and has a short while ago come to be a well-liked, economical jewellery stone. Though green quartz almost never occurs in nature, gem dealers can heat treat mild-colored amethyst to produce this gem. (Amethyst could be the purple variety of quartz).

If you want residing dangerously, contemplate adding an ekanite towards your assortment. While its muted olive green shade won't scream "Hazard," this mineral contains uranium and thorium, rendering it really radioactive.
